			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.ajc.com/metro/content/metro/stories/2007/10/26/genarlow_1026.html" target="_blank"><img src="http://img.coxnewsweb.com/C/08/62/01/image_6001628.jpg" align="left" height="138" hspace="12" width="170" /></a>Well, isn&#8217;t that something?</p>
<p>According the <a href="http://www.ajc.com/metro/content/metro/stories/2007/10/26/genarlow_1026.html" target="_blank"><strong>Atlanta Journal-Constitution</strong></a>, the Georgia State Supreme Court has ordered Genarlow Wilson be released from prison. According to the AJC:</p>
<p><img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/start_quote_rb.gif" align="left" height="13" width="24" />The court&#8217;s 4-3 decision upholds a Monroe County judge&#8217;s ruling that the sentence constituted cruel and unusual punishment under both the Georgia and U.S. constitutions.</p>
<p>The majority opinion said the sentence appeared to be &#8220;grossly disproportionate&#8221; to the teenager&#8217;s crime and noted that it was out of step with current law.<img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/end_quote_rb.gif" /></p>
<p>And according to an AP report, via <a href="http://www.nytimes.com/aponline/us/AP-Teen-Sex-Case.html?_r=1&amp;hp&amp;oref=slogin" target="_blank">the NYT</a>, Chief Justice Leah Ward Sears wrote in the majority opinion on the 4-3 opinion that:</p>
<p align="Center"><span id="more-180"></span></p>
<p><img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/start_quote_rb.gif" align="left" height="13" width="24" />&#8230;the severe punishment makes &#8221;no measurable contribution to acceptable goals of punishment&#8221; and that Wilson&#8217;s crime did not rise to the &#8221;level of adults who prey on children.&#8221; <img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/end_quote_rb.gif" /></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="http://www.sportspad.org/images/genarlow-wilson-in-prision_54.jpg" alt="Genarlow Wilson ID tag" align="left" height="141" hspace="12" vspace="6" width="228" />In front of tomorrow&#8217;s trial on Genarlow Wilson&#8217;s appeal, <em>The Atlanta Journal Constitution</em> (AJC), <a href="http://www.ajc.com/wireless/content/metro/stories/2007/07/19/wilson_0720.html" target="_blank">has a story on his lawyer</a>, BJ Bernstein. At the center of the story is a question about the many ways she has kept Wilson&#8217;s story in the media.</p>
<p>And it&#8217;s interesting, no? On the one hand we imagine that too much media attention perverts justice, insofar as it gives us a sense that a case is more about public opinion than it is about &#8220;the law.&#8221; But that might be more an argument regarding the Paris Hiltons, and less one for the Genarlow Wilsons.</p>
<p><span id="more-143"></span></p>
<p>Without media attention, where would this case be, really? Clearly the attention has made the district attorney, David McDade, nervous. Wanting his own slice of media approbation likely figured in his decision to release the sex tape used in Wilson&#8217;s original trial. And <em>that&#8217;s</em> nasty. As I&#8217;ve noted <a href="http://www.reason.com/blog/show/121380.html#744664">in a comment elsewhere</a>, McDade&#8217;s failure to block out the faces on the video speaks to a fundamental disregard for meaningful justice and to his disengagement with the alleged victims in this case. This, it seems, is less about justice and more about winning. Right now, it looks like McDade is the one lacking confidence in the &#8220;facts&#8221; of the case.</p>
<p>My heart sinks when I think of that tape because I am hard pressed to imagine that something bad didn&#8217;t happen to those girls that night. And whether that thing be about teen sex, about athletes and groupies, or even about some astonishingly bad judgment, one thing remains&#8211; something likely wasn&#8217;t right. But those girls&#8217; voices are noticibly absent from the aftermath, so I dance around this point, not knowing what that night was supposed to mean to them. I like to imagine this silence has been a matter of self-protection, even as the tape release might potentially destroy that as well.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s hard, but this case isn&#8217;t about the sex; it&#8217;s about the adjudication thereof. With bad judgment Wilson made himself vulnerable to the law, but it is the law&#8217;s&#8211; the DA and attorney general&#8217;s&#8211; zealotry that makes the consequences of that bad judgment suspicious, as the notion of justice is overtaken by the desire to punish something else or something &#8220;more.&#8221;</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wilsonappeal.com/petition.php"><img src="http://tbn0.google.com/images?q=tbn:DMJ1pnQo-0X1CM:http://www.wilsonappeal.com/genarlow_art.jpg" align="right" height="136" hspace="3" vspace="6" width="99" /></a>As <a href="http://writ.news.findlaw.com/colb/20070110.html">Sherry F. Colb</a> points out, &#8220;If we did not know that Wilson&#8217;s disturbing predicament had arisen in the United States, we might assume that we were hearing about a case in a theocracy. His case, however, sheds light on a disturbing fact regarding our criminal justice system, a reality about which we have grown complacent: people in the U.S. are routinely condemned to spend years in brutal prisons as punishment for behavior that harms no one&#8230; [T]his treatment of victimless crime is symptomatic of a criminal law that is strongly influenced by religious views about sexual morality.&#8221;</p>
<p>But maybe this all moot, for it is my impression that any final decisions will be made in regards to which legal and legislative apparatuses have the legal right to &#8220;make the call.&#8221;</p>
<p>An interesting read? <a href="http://http://transcripts.cnn.com/TRANSCRIPTS/0702/17/cnr.07.html">An old CNN transcript, in which the tape is discussed</a>. The jury was unaminous that no rape had occurred, but were required to make their judgment (apparently the jury foreman started crying while reading the sentence?) based on the law.</p>
<p>The president cannot pardon Genarlow Wilson, nor can Georgia&#8217;s  Governor. Wilson, no matter what we think <em>should</em> happen, is deeply entangled in the system, and at this point only the system can make this right.</p>
<p>Or the prosecutor, Eddie Barker, who has the power to set the sentence aside.</p>
<p>But we know where he stands, apparently <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wilson_v._State_of_Georgia#Appeals">claiming that</a> &#8220;the one person who can change things at this point is Genarlow. The ball&#8217;s in his court.&#8221;</p>
<p>No, Eddie, it&#8217;s in yours.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Following up on my <a href="http://mp285.com/2007/obama-on-scooter-libby-and-genarlow-wilson/">previous Obama post</a>, and also on the <a href="http://mp285.com/2007/a-genarlow-wilson-primer/">Genarlow Wilson updates</a>, <em>The Atlanta Journal Constitution</em> has <strong><a href="http://www.ajc.com/search/content/genarlow.html">this</a></strong> story on the charges being sought against the prosecutor in the Genarlow Wilson case, for showing further signs of &#8220;overzealous&#8221; prosecution in distributing the sex tape that helped convict him. The connection?</p>
<p><span id="more-131"></span></p>
<p><img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/start_quote_rb.gif" alt="" />Some of the group, all of whom are African-American, compared McDade&#8217;s actions to those of Mike Nifong, the district attorney in North Carolina recently sanctioned for zealous prosecution of Duke lacrosse players who eventually were cleared of rape charges. They suggested McDade should be prosecuted criminally for distributing a tape that shows Wilson, who was 17 at the time, having consensual oral sex with a 15-year-old.<img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/nol/shared/img/v3/end_quote_rb.gif" alt="" /></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>According to this story by Christi Parsons in the <em>Chicago Tribune</em>, Barack Obama came with it during a Democratic candidate&#8217;s forum yesterday to the NAACP (story below). The article compares his statements to the NAACP with a speech he gave at Howard University, where he spoke in &#8220;mostly lofty terms.&#8221; At<a href="http://www.stereohyped.com/obamarama/obamarama-39-20070713/"> the NAACP event in Detroit</a>, however, Parsons&#8217; describes Obama&#8217;s statements as combining &#8220;his intellectual assessment of social problems with a stronger does of personal feeling.&#8221;</p>
<p><span id="more-129"></span></p>
<p><a href="http://news.bbc.co.uk/1/hi/programmes/this_world/6677057.stm" target="_blank"><img src="http://newsimg.bbc.co.uk/media/images/42952000/jpg/_42952279_racehatelouisiana.jpg" title="Jesse Rae Beard, Jena Six" alt="Jesse Rae Beard, Jena Six" align="left" height="101" hspace="12" vspace="6" width="135" /></a>What Parsons&#8217; refers to as &#8220;the personal&#8221; in Obama&#8217;s remarks I simply see as his willingness to speak on silence and inaction in the media&#8211; especially when it comes to justice for black people. And even though he&#8217;s not talking about anything new, there <em>is</em> something particularly striking in the specter of disproportionate sentencing in this cultural moment, this moment of <a href="http://theorymyculture.wordpress.com/2007/06/10/free-paris-part-ii/" target="_blank">Paris Hilton</a> and Scooter Libby, of <a href="http://mp285.com/2007/a-genarlow-wilson-primer/">Genarlow Wilson</a>, the <a href="http://mp285.com/2007/without-grace-sakia-gunn-and-the-newark-lesbian-conviction/">Newark lesbians sentencing</a>, and the <a href="http://elleabd.blogspot.com/2007/05/jena-six.html" target="_blank">Jena Six.</a> (Jesse Rae Beard, one of the h.s. students, is pictured, left.) Obama took a good opportunity for shifting the norm, by using specific examples to make other candidates seem too abstract and less connected to the cultural moment, without affecting his own reputation for being &#8220;intellectual,&#8221; but here humanized, relatable.</p>
